GC China Turbine Corp. Continues Delays Filing of Annual Report on Form 10-K for 2011 and Form 10-Q for the Period Ended March 31, 2012

2012-05-18 22:00 3415

NEW YORK, May 18, 2012 /PRNewswire-Asia/ -- GC China Turbine Corporation ("GC China" or the "Company") (OTC.BB: GCHTE.OB) today announce that it will be unable to file its Annual Report on Form 10-K for the year ended December 31, 2011 (the "Form 10-K") on the previously anticipated date of May 15th, 2012 because of the extensive work required to re-audit the financial statements for the years ended December 31st 2010, 2009 and 2008 by the Company's new independent accounting firm. Additionally, due to this continued delay, the Company will also have to delay the filing of its quarterly report on Form 10-Q for the period ended March 31, 2012 (the "Form 10-Q").

GC China is currently working to finalize its Form 10-K and Form 10-Q and expects to file them before June 30th 2012. However, no assurance can be given as to the exact date that the Form 10-K and Form 10-Q will be completed and filed.

About GC China Turbine Corp.

GC China is a manufacturer of state-of-the-art 2-blade and 3-blade wind turbines based in Wuhan City of Hubei Province, China. The Company holds a license to manufacture what it believes is a groundbreaking technology which meets rigorous requirements for low cost and high reliability.
